No, you cannot appear for the ISI entrance exam for the B.Stat. (Bachelor of Statistics) course solely with Applied Mathematics and English. The eligibility criteria require Mathematics, not Applied Mathematics. To be eligible for the ISI B.Stat. entrance exam, you must have successfully completed 10+2 years of Higher Secondary Education (or equivalent) with Mathematics and English as subjects. While both subjects involve mathematical concepts, Mathematics forms the foundation, whereas Applied Mathematics focuses on using those concepts to solve real-world problems. The ISI B.Stat. program requires a strong foundation in core mathematical concepts. I hope it helps!

No, you cannot apply or register for both BMS and B.Com together at St. Xavier's College,Mumbai.St. Xavier's conducts an entrance exam for admission to BMS, while B.Com admissions are based on Class 12 marks. These are separate admission processes. Mumbai University, to which St. Xavier College is affiliated might not allow applying for multiple degree courses at the same time. Once you are enrolled in one course, your documents might be held by the college making it difficult to register for another.

Psychology, as defined by the American Psychological Association, is the systematic examination of human behavior and mental processes. This interdisciplinary field comprises various subfields, each dedicated to distinct facets of human behavior and cognition. Subfields encompass Brain Science and Cognitive Psychology, Clinical Psychology, and Counselling Psychology.
